Walter Gunter was born in 1854 in Arkansas, the child of Thomas Leroy Gunter and Matilda Mannion Manning. In 1860, Walter Gunter resided in Lapile, Union Springs, Union, Arkansas, USA. In 1870, Walter Gunter resided in Lapile, Union, Arkansas, USA. Walter Gunter married Sarah Sally Norris, Susan Culpepper, Julia Slater, and had children including Russell Brantley, Henry L. Gunter, Alice Brantley, Bessie Alma Gunter, Loula Bird Gunter. Walter Gunter passed away in 1921 in Union, Louisiana, United States.
